What Are Fillable PDF Forms?

Fillable PDF forms are interactive PDF documents that contain form fields where users can enter information directly into the document. Unlike static PDFs that require printing and manual completion, fillable forms allow digital input, making data collection faster, more accurate, and environmentally friendly.

These forms can include various field types such as text boxes, checkboxes, radio buttons, dropdown menus, and even signature fields. Once completed, users can save the filled form, email it, or submit it directly through an integrated system.

💡 Pro Tip:

Fillable PDF forms maintain their formatting across all devices and operating systems, ensuring your form looks professional whether opened on Windows, Mac, mobile devices, or in web browsers.

Types of PDF Form Fields

1. Text Fields

Single or multi-line text input boxes for names, addresses, comments, etc.

Best for: Open-ended responses, personal information, descriptions

2. Checkboxes

Square boxes that users can check or uncheck, allowing multiple selections.

Best for: Multiple choice questions, terms acceptance, feature selections

3. Radio Buttons

Circular buttons for mutually exclusive options (only one can be selected).

Best for: Yes/No questions, rating scales, single-choice options

4. Dropdown Lists

Space-saving menus with predefined options.

Best for: State/country selection, categories, long option lists

5. Signature Fields

Special fields for digital signatures or initials.

Best for: Contracts, approvals, legal documents

6. Date Fields

Formatted fields specifically for date entry with calendar pickers.

Best for: Birth dates, appointment scheduling, deadlines

Best Practices for Creating PDF Forms

Design & Layout

  • ✓ Use clear, concise labels
  • ✓ Group related fields together
  • ✓ Maintain consistent spacing and alignment
  • ✓ Use white space effectively
  • ✓ Make required fields obvious (asterisk or bold)

User Experience

  • ✓ Keep forms as short as possible
  • ✓ Use dropdown menus for long option lists
  • ✓ Provide clear instructions
  • ✓ Add helpful tooltips or examples
  • ✓ Use radio buttons instead of checkboxes for single choices

Technical Optimization

  • ✓ Use descriptive field names for data export
  • ✓ Set appropriate field sizes
  • ✓ Enable multi-line text for longer responses
  • ✓ Use proper validation formats (email, phone, zip)
  • ✓ Test across different PDF readers

Accessibility

  • ✓ Use sufficient color contrast
  • ✓ Add alt text for images
  • ✓ Ensure keyboard navigation works
  • ✓ Use readable font sizes (minimum 11pt)
  • ✓ Provide text alternatives for visual elements

Common Mistakes to Avoid

❌ Making Every Field Required

Only mark truly essential fields as required. Too many mandatory fields discourage completion.

❌ Using Inconsistent Field Sizes

Match field sizes to expected input length. A single-letter field shouldn't be as wide as an address field.

❌ Poor Tab Order

Users should be able to tab through fields logically. Test your tab order before distributing.

❌ No Validation

Add format validation for emails, phones, dates, etc. This ensures data quality.

❌ Forgetting to Test

Always test your form on different devices and PDF readers before distribution.

Advanced Form Features

Calculated Fields

Add automatic calculations for invoices, order forms, and financial documents. Fields can multiply, sum, average, and perform other mathematical operations.

Conditional Logic

Show or hide fields based on user responses. For example, only show shipping address if "ship to different address" is checked.

Digital Signatures
